Travel Tips for a Perfect Lapland Holiday
Planning a winter trip to Lapland requires preparation. The weather is cold, but with the right planning, the journey becomes comfortable and rewarding.
Dress for Arctic Weather
Layered clothing is essential. Thermal base layers, insulated jackets, gloves, and snow boots help protect against temperatures that often drop below freezing.
Choose the Right Time to Visit
The best months for winter travel are December through March. Snow conditions are ideal during this period, and the chances of seeing the northern lights are higher.
